Soak In Sunlight: A Solo Exhibitions’ Journey Into Nature

Article Featured Image

Aprille Zammit’s solo exhibition, ‘Soak in Sunlight’, opens at Marie Gallery 5, inviting visitors to explore how we interact with the natural world.

Running from 24th October to 7th November, this exhibition is a reminder of the beauty that surrounds us, often overlooked in our busy lives.

Zammit’s work encourages us to pause and appreciate the simple elements of nature. The hues of the sky at sunrise and sunset, the calming presence of the sea, and the warmth of sunlight.

In her artistic practice, she emphasises the importance of framing these experiences, suggesting that by consciously acknowledging our surroundings we can cultivate mindfulness and a deeper appreciation of what mother nature offers us.

Rather than focusing solely on tangible achievements, Zammit makes it a point of the need to celebrate the serenity of the natural environment.

In ‘Soak in Sunlight’, Zammit aims to create spaces for reflection, encouraging viewers to lean into nature’s inherent beauty.

This exhibition not only showcases her talent but also is a powerful reminder of the beauty that exists in our everyday lives.
